Frequently Asked Questions

How many health care nonprofits are in California?

There are 95 health care nonprofits in California, with $10.3B in combined revenue and $8.1B in total assets.

What is the largest health care nonprofit in California?

The largest health care nonprofit in California by revenue is Altamed Health Services Corp with $1.8B in annual revenue.
